Latest Patents
Wang's latest patents include a "Memory control circuit with distributed architecture." This invention discloses a device that features a distributed controller and a common controller. The distributed controller generates an output voltage based on a control signal, while the common controller includes a feedback loop that stabilizes this control signal. Another notable patent is the "Bias control circuit with distributed architecture for memory cells." This device comprises a selected distributed driver and two feedback control circuits, ensuring that the output remains within predetermined ranges for optimal performance.
